Square is currently using this engine for FFXIV. Or rather... FFXVI used FFXIV's engine with some tweaks to it. CBU3 apparently didn't want to relearn their entire workflow for FFXVI by using a new engine, so they stuck with what was familiar.

What's great about this is that FFXIV is now in the process of getting a bunch of graphical updates imported to it from FFXVI and is now looking better than ever!

u/Status_Jellyfish_213 Jun 09 '26 edited Jun 09 '26

Yup I’ve just dealt with this exact problem.

I used https://www.nexusmods.com/finalfantasy7rebirth/mods/3?tab=posts and https://www.nexusmods.com/finalfantasy7rebirth/mods/1.

Then I updated directStorage to the latest version https://steamcommunity.com/app/2909400/discussions/0/597391244545502777/.

After that I edited Engine.ini to force dynamic resolution off (this may cause performance issues if you have a weaker system or are not using DLSS / FSR or frame gen and rely on it, however the implementation itself causes stutters).

[SystemSettings]
r.DynamicRes.OperationMode=0

Even though it was already technically off in settings by both being set to 100%, I still found that setting helped.

Between these I have eliminated all stuttering
